(jiāng) - Thick liquid & paste

Tone 1

jiāng | 10 strokes | radical:

· jiāng

Thick liquid;

paste;

starch;

syrup;

to starch (clothes);

pulp;

slurry.

Examples

  • The porridge is too thick (粥太浆了).
  • She starched the shirt (她把衬衫浆了).
  • This is fruit pulp (这是果浆).
  • The paper is made from wood pulp (纸是用木浆做的).

Collocations

  • Starch clothes(浆衣服)
  • Fruit pulp(果浆)
  • Paper pulp(纸浆)
  • Bean starch(豆浆)
  • Thick liquid(浆液)
  • Mud slurry(泥浆)
